Overpronation is a common biomechanical issue where the foot rolls too far inward during walking or running, placing excessive strain on the ankles and arches .

Comfortwiz in Kissimmee Orthotics can significantly help with overpronation by:

  • Providing Arch Support: Orthotic inserts support your arches, which is crucial for preventing overpronation .

  • Counteracting Inward Rolling: Firm, supportive insoles can counteract the inward rolling motion of the foot, improving overall alignment and efficiency .

  • Correcting Gait Problems: Orthotics are shoe inserts specifically recommended to correct issues in your gait or foot structure, with overpronation being a primary example .

  • Enhancing Stability: Insoles and orthotics that offer extra stability and support are highly beneficial for individuals who overpronate.
